      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;EM&gt;"tried that, didnt change a thing :-("&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Last effort! Do make sure you don't have &lt;U&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;any off brand&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/U&gt; attachments on the T5i.&amp;nbsp; Not even an off brand lens. Make sure you have a fully charged &lt;STRONG&gt;Canon battery&lt;/STRONG&gt;. &lt;U&gt;&amp;lt;--- very important&lt;/U&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;Make sure you have a brand new SD card and make&amp;nbsp;sure it is a known name brand not some Walmart/Dollar General store brand.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Do the reset once more. Menus, tools, clear all settings and &lt;STRONG&gt;Clear all custom settings.&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Put the Rebel in P mode.&amp;nbsp; ISO 200. One shot. Daylight WB. Mount a Canon lens and try to take some shots outdoors on a nice day. If it works, it works.&amp;nbsp; If it didin't it is faulty and not a good candidate for repair even at a shop that may still service Rebel T5i. The used value of a fully functioning T5i isn't very much, less than $200 bucks, guessing, so this limits the service cost. BTW, don't even think FW upgrade.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Makes a new T8i pretty tempting, doesn't it?&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;img id="smileyhappy" class="emoticon emoticon-smileyhappy" src="https://community.usa.canon.com/i/smilies/16x16_smiley-happy.png" alt="Smiley Happy" title="Smiley Happy" /&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
